Blues School: Ending #4

piano-ology-blues-school-ending-04-featured

An old school ending copped from Take the A Train…

Don’t forget to swing the eight notes!

Pattern Recognition…

  • Unison in both hands: 1-3-4-#4-5-6-5-1
  • Followed by a Dominant7,#9 stinger!

Homework: Play in as many other keys you expect to play in!
